## Changelog — Quillseek v2.8.0

Defaults changed after the autocomplete index regression in staging. Index rebuild concurrency dropped from 8 to 2; p95 suggest latency had climbed past 900ms under rebuild load. Prefix cache TTL raised, cold-shard warmup now mandatory. Security note: the rebuild worker no longer runs with the ingest role; it uses a scoped read-only credential. No external surface changes; all ports unchanged. Review the permission diff before sign-off. Current effective defaults for the suggest service are listed below.

service settings:
[casax]
port = 6379
team = rusir
host = casax.zemvarhq.corp
region = outer-4
access_code = ac_9808ce
timeout_ms = 1500

### Account Recovery — Catalogue Import (Lintwood)

Quick one for review: when the Lintwood catalogue import wipes a patron's session table, the recovery flow re-seeds accounts from the nightly snapshot. Check that the importer skips locked accounts — last time it didn't. To rerun recovery against staging you'll need the vault passphrase, which is appended just below.

recovery phrase for yafof-tajof: julmir-kelax-julvan-holath-belvan-holir-ralael-ralvan-ralath-julvan-silmir-istmir-kaswyn-ulamir

Ticket: Vault locked on build cluster Copperline. Clock skew between agents brick-7 and brick-9 exceeded the 90-second tolerance, so the Keyhaven vault refused token renewal and locked itself. Builds queued behind it are stalled. Support: first resync NTP on both agents, confirm drift is under five seconds, then restart the vault agent. Do not force-unseal before resync or the lock counter increments again. Once time is consistent, run the recovery flow from the vault console and supply the passphrase provided below.

unlock words, kajef-kadug: sorys-pelax-lamael-tamvan-briiel-novdor-fenwyn-tamdor-oliion-keleth-julok-belion-ralok

Ticket PRW-318: Expired credentials blocking password reset revamp rollout

The staging deploy of the revamped reset flow is failing because the token-mint service credential expired Friday. This blocks the release candidate for Bramblewick 4.2. A replacement credential has been issued with the same scopes (mint, verify, revoke) and a 90-day lifetime. Release manager: please confirm the new value lands in the deploy secrets before tomorrow's cut. The reissued key is below.

gateway credential: kto23_LX9A4ys6i4nzHtpOLNLodKK